Esempio n. 1
0
 public Projetos BuscarPorId(int id)
 {
     using (RomanContext ctx = new RomanContext())
     {
         return(ctx.Projetos.Find(id));
     }
 }
Esempio n. 2
0
 public List <TiposUsuario> Listar()
 {
     using (RomanContext ctx = new RomanContext())
     {
         return(ctx.TiposUsuario.ToList());
     }
 }
 public List <Projetos> Listar()
 {
     using (RomanContext ctx = new RomanContext())
     {
         return(ctx.Projetos.Include(x => x.IdTemaNavigation).ToList());
     }
 }
Esempio n. 4
0
 public List <Usuarios> Listar()
 {
     using (RomanContext ctx = new RomanContext())
     {
         return(ctx.Usuarios.ToList());
     }
 }
 public List <Projeto> ListarPorTema(int idTema)
 {
     using (RomanContext ctx = new RomanContext())
     {
         return(ctx.Projeto.Where(x => x.IdTema == idTema).ToList());
     }
 }
Esempio n. 6
0
        public IActionResult AtualizarTema(Temas tema)
        {
            try
            {
                using (RomanContext ctx = new RomanContext())
                {
                    Temas temaExiste = ctx.Temas.Find(tema.Id);

                    if (temaExiste == null)
                    {
                        return(NotFound());
                    }

                    temaExiste.Nome = tema.Nome;

                    ctx.Temas.Update(temaExiste);
                    ctx.SaveChanges();
                }
                return(Ok());
            }
            catch (Exception)
            {
                return(BadRequest());
            }
        }
 public List <Projetos> Listar()
 {
     using (RomanContext ctx = new RomanContext())
     {
         return(ctx.Projetos.ToList());
     }
 }
Esempio n. 8
0
 public Usuarios BuscarPorEmailESenha(LoginViewModel login)
 {
     using (RomanContext ctx = new RomanContext())
     {
         return(ctx.Usuarios.Include(x => x.IdTipoUsuariosNavigation).FirstOrDefault(x => x.DsEMail == login.Email && x.DsSenha == login.Senha));
     }
 }
 public List <Temas> ListarTodos()
 {
     using (RomanContext ctx = new RomanContext())
     {
         return(ctx.Temas.ToList());
     }
 }
Esempio n. 10
0
        public List <Usuarios> BuscarUsuarioPorArea(string equipe)
        {
            using (RomanContext ctx = new RomanContext())
            {
                List <Usuarios> ListaUsuarioProcurado = ctx.Usuarios.Include(x => x.UsuariosEquipes).Include("UsuariosEquipes.Equipes").ToList();

                List <Usuarios> listaFiltrados = new List <Usuarios>();

                foreach (Usuarios item in ListaUsuarioProcurado)
                {
                    foreach (UsuariosEquipes usuarioEquip in item.UsuariosEquipes)
                    {
                        if (usuarioEquip.Equipes.Nome == equipe)
                        {
                            listaFiltrados.Add(item);
                        }
                    }
                }

                if (ListaUsuarioProcurado == null)
                {
                    return(null);
                }
                return(listaFiltrados);
            }
        }
Esempio n. 11
0
 public List <Professor> Listar()
 {
     using (RomanContext ctx = new RomanContext())
     {
         return(ctx.Professor.ToList());
     }
 }
 public Temas BuscarPorId(int id)
 {
     using (RomanContext ctx = new RomanContext())
     {
         return(ctx.Temas.Find(id));
     }
 }
Esempio n. 13
0
 public List <Equipe> Listar()
 {
     using (RomanContext ctx = new RomanContext())
     {
         return(ctx.Equipe.Include(C => C.Usuarios).ToList());
     }
 }
 public List <Equipe> Listar()
 {
     using (RomanContext ctx = new RomanContext())
     {
         return(ctx.Equipe.ToList());
     }
 }
 public List <Tema> Listar()
 {
     using (RomanContext ctx = new RomanContext())
     {
         return(ctx.Tema.ToList());
     }
 }
Esempio n. 16
0
 public Usuario BuscarPorEmailSenha(string email, string senha)
 {
     using (RomanContext ctx = new RomanContext())
     {
         return(ctx.Usuario.FirstOrDefault(u => u.Email == email && u.Senha == senha));
     }
 }
Esempio n. 17
0
 public void Deletar(Usuarios usuario)
 {
     using (RomanContext ctx = new RomanContext())
     {
         ctx.Usuarios.Remove(usuario);
         ctx.SaveChanges();
     }
 }
Esempio n. 18
0
 public void CadastrarPermissao(Permissao perm)
 {
     using (RomanContext ctx = new RomanContext())
     {
         ctx.Permissao.Add(perm);
         ctx.SaveChanges();
     };
 }
Esempio n. 19
0
 public void Cadastrar(Equipe equipe)
 {
     using (RomanContext ctx = new RomanContext())
     {
         ctx.Equipe.Add(equipe);
         ctx.SaveChanges();
     }
 }
Esempio n. 20
0
 public void Deletar(Tema tema)
 {
     using (RomanContext ctx = new RomanContext())
     {
         ctx.Tema.Remove(tema);
         ctx.SaveChanges();
     }
 }
 public void Atualizar(Temas tema)
 {
     using (RomanContext ctx = new RomanContext())
     {
         ctx.Temas.Update(tema);
         ctx.SaveChanges();
     }
 }
Esempio n. 22
0
 public void AtualizarProjeto(Projetos projeto)
 {
     using (RomanContext ctx = new RomanContext())
     {
         ctx.Projetos.Update(projeto);
         ctx.SaveChanges();
     }
 }
 public void Cadastrar(Temas tema)
 {
     using (RomanContext ctx = new RomanContext())
     {
         ctx.Temas.Add(tema);
         ctx.SaveChanges();
     }
 }
 public void Deletar(int id)
 {
     using (RomanContext ctx = new RomanContext())
     {
         ctx.Usuarios.Remove(ctx.Usuarios.Find(id));
         ctx.SaveChanges();
     }
 }
Esempio n. 25
0
 public void Cadastrar(Usuarios usuario)
 {
     using (RomanContext ctx = new RomanContext())
     {
         ctx.Usuarios.Add(usuario);
         ctx.SaveChanges();
     }
 }
Esempio n. 26
0
 public void Cadastrar(Professor professor)
 {
     using (RomanContext ctx = new RomanContext())
     {
         ctx.Professor.Add(professor);
         ctx.SaveChanges();
     }
 }
Esempio n. 27
0
 public void Cadastrar(Grupo grupo)
 {
     using (RomanContext ctx = new RomanContext())
     {
         ctx.Grupo.Add(grupo);
         ctx.SaveChanges();
     }
 }
Esempio n. 28
0
 public Temas BuscarPorId(int id)
 {
     using (RomanContext ctx = new RomanContext())
     {
         Temas temaBuscado = ctx.Temas.FirstOrDefault(x => x.IdTema == id);
         return(temaBuscado);
     }
 }
Esempio n. 29
0
 public void Cadastrar(Projetos projetos)
 {
     using (RomanContext ctx = new RomanContext())
     {
         ctx.Projetos.Add(projetos);
         ctx.SaveChanges();
     }
 }
Esempio n. 30
0
 public void Atualizar(Usuarios usuario)
 {
     using (RomanContext ctx = new RomanContext())
     {
         ctx.Usuarios.Update(usuario);
         ctx.SaveChanges();
     }
 }